כיצד ללמוד מעטפת Scripting על ידי התקנת Tor Browser

La כיתה שביעית (7) של הקורס העיוני המעשי של "למד Scripting Shell" נלמד כיצד באמצעות א תסריט אנחנו יכולים להשיג קל התקנה והתקנה מתוכנת של המפורסמים והשימושיים דפדפן האינטרנט דפדפן Tor, בעוד, כמו תמיד, אנו משקיעים זמן יקר להבין כיצד כל שורה, כל פקודה, כל משתנה עובדים, כדי להבין וללמוד Scripting של Shell.

מעטפת Scriptingאך לאותם מעטים שמבינים, נבהיר שכן דפדפן Tor. זהו יישום מרובה צורות (Windows / Linux) המאפשר לנו להסתיר או להסוות את זהותנו ברשת. הוא מספק מסלול אנונימי דרך שרתי פרוקסי לתקשורת האינטרנט שלנו ומונע ביעילות ניתוח תעבורה חיצוני. אז שימוש בטור זה אפשרי ליצור חיבור למארח, כמעט באופן בלתי מורגש, כלומר בלי שהוא או כל אחד אחר יוכלו לדעת את ה- IP שלנו.

להוציא להורג דפדפן Tor ב מערכת הפעלה GNU / Linux, בדרך כלל עובד בנפרד עם מנהל גרפי שנקרא Vidalia ובדפדפן אינטרנט התואם טורבוטון, תוסף עבור Mozilla Firefox שמאפשר לנו להפעיל אותו מהדפדפן עצמו. עם זאת, ב דפדפן Torיוצריו הצליחו לפשט הכל, בעיצוב יישום (חבילה) יציב וחזק בצורה אינטגרלית, כלומר עם כל הדרוש לעבודה מיידית בכל הפצה.

דפדפן Tor זה קל מאוד לשימוש, לאחר ההתקנה וההפעלה אין מעט או שום דבר להגדיר, אלא אם כן אתה משתמש מתקדם מאוד או פרנואידי לגבי אבטחה ופרטיות.

הנה סקריפט Bash Shell:

================================================== ====================
#!/bin/bash
#####################################################################
# EN ESTA SECCIÓN INCLUYA LOS DATOS DEL CREADOR Y EL PROGRAMA
#
#####################################################################


#####################################################################
# EN ESTA SECCIÓN INCLUYA LOS DERECHOS DE AUTOR Y LICENCIAMIENTO 
# DEL SOFTWARE
# 
#####################################################################

#####################################################################
# INICIO DEL MODULO DE TOR BROWSER                                     
#####################################################################

USER_NAME=`cat /etc/passwd | grep 1000 | cut -d: -f1`

HOME_USER_NAME=/home/$USER_NAME

cd $HOME_USER_NAME

rm -rf /opt/tor-browser*

rm -f /usr/bin/tor-browser*

rm -rf /usr/bin/tor-browser*

rm -f $HOME_USER_NAME/Escritorio/tor-browser.desktop

rm -f $HOME_USER_NAME/Desktop/tor-browser.desktop

rm -f $HOME_USER_NAME/.local/share/applications/tor-browser.desktop

rm -f /usr/share/applications/tor-browser.desktop

update-menus

#####################################################################

# wget -c https://dist.torproject.org/torbrowser/5.0.7/tor-browser-linux32-5.0.7_es-ES.tar.xz

# wget -c https://dist.torproject.org/torbrowser/5.0.7/tor-browser-linux64-5.0.7_es-ES.tar.xz

# Nota: Puede descargarlos manualmente desde esta URL: https://dist.torproject.org/torbrowser/

#####################################################################

unxz *tor-browser*.tar.xz

tar xvf *tor-browser*.tar

mv -f tor-browser_es-ES /opt/tor-browser

ln -f -s /opt/tor-browser/Browser/start-tor-browser /usr/bin/tor-browser

#####################################################################

chown $USER_NAME:$USER_NAME -R /opt/tor-browser/


echo '
[Desktop Entry]
Name=TOR Browser
GenericName=TOR Browser
GenericName[es]=Navegador web TOR
Comment=Navegador de Internet seguro
Exec=/usr/bin/tor-browser
Icon=/opt/tor-browser/Browser/browser/icons/mozicon128.png
Terminal=false
Type=Application
Encoding=UTF-8
Categories=Network;Application;
MimeType=x-scheme-handler/mozilla;
X-KDE-Protocols=mozilla
' > /opt/tor-browser/tor-browser.desktop


ln -s /opt/tor-browser/tor-browser.desktop $HOME_USER_NAME/Escritorio/tor-browser.desktop

chown $USER_NAME:$USER_NAME $HOME_USER_NAME/Escritorio/tor-browser.desktop

chmod 755 $HOME_USER_NAME/Escritorio/tor-browser.desktop

chmod +x $HOME_USER_NAME/Escritorio/tor-browser.desktop


ln -s /opt/tor-browser/tor-browser.desktop $HOME_USER_NAME/Desktop/tor-browser.desktop

chown $USER_NAME:$USER_NAME $HOME_USER_NAME/Desktop/tor-browser.desktop

chmod 755 $HOME_USER_NAME/Desktop/tor-browser.desktop

chmod +x $HOME_USER_NAME/Desktop/tor-browser.desktop


ln -s /opt/tor-browser/tor-browser.desktop $HOME_USER_NAME/.local/share/applications/tor-browser.desktop

chown $USER_NAME:$USER_NAME $HOME_USER_NAME/.local/share/applications/tor-browser.desktop

chmod 755 $HOME_USER_NAME/.local/share/applications/tor-browser.desktop

chmod +x $HOME_USER_NAME/.local/share/applications/tor-browser.desktop


ln -s /opt/tor-browser/tor-browser.desktop /usr/share/applications/tor-browser.desktop

chown $USER_NAME:$USER_NAME /usr/share/applications/tor-browser.desktop

chmod 755 /usr/share/applications/tor-browser.desktop

chmod +x /usr/share/applications/tor-browser.desktop


su - $USER_NAME -c "tor-browser https://addons.mozilla.org/firefox/downloads/latest/11356/addon-11356-latest.xpi?src=dp-btn-primary" &

#####################################################################

rm -f $HOME_USER_NAME/tor-browser*.*

rm -f $HOME_USER_NAME/*.xpi

clear

su - $USER_NAME -c "xdg-open 'https://dist.torproject.org/torbrowser/'" &

clear

echo ''
echo ''
echo '#--------------------------------------------------------------#'
echo '#  GRACIAS POR USAR ESTE SCRIPT DE INSTALACIÓN DE TOR BROWSER  #'
echo '#--------------------------------------------------------------#'
echo ''
echo ''

sleep 3

#####################################################################
# FINAL DEL MODULO DE TOR BROWSER                                      
#####################################################################
================================================== ====================

הערה: אני אישית לא משתמש דפדפן Tor כי אני לא מנווט ב- רשת עמוקה או שאני חושש א רובו o גרזן על המידע שלי או על הפרת פרטיותי, אך אני יודע שרבים עושים ועבורם את תסריט ההתקנה הזה, אשר יקל על חייהם.

היתרון של סקריפטים אלה הוא בכך שהם מאפשרים את שניהם Mozilla Firefox כמו טור עיוןr מוגדרים בצורה כזו ש לאפשר עדכון של אותו דבר, כפי שזה נעשה בחלונות. כלומר, פתיחת ה- לחצן התפריט של סרגל הקסמים, פתיחת תפריט העזרה (סמל השאלה) ובחלון הקופץ שיוצא (אודות ...) הוא סורק אחר עדכונים ממתינים והעדכון מתבצע בשקיפות כמו ב- Windows.

זכור כי במקרה של יצירת תסריט (דוגמא: mi-script-tor-browser.sh) עם קוד זה, אני ממליץ לך להוריד ידנית את הקובץ מ דפדפן Tor מתעדכן ידנית, כך שאתה צריך להמשיך להגיב wget הורדות שורות, והניחו אותו ב path / home / my_user יחד עם הקובץ tar.gz de דפדפן Tor הורד והפעל אותו עם פקודת הפקודה $ לחבוט mi-script-tor-browser.sh . ותוך פחות מ -30 שניות יהיה לך הכל פונקציונלי. אחרי זה אתה יכול לנווט בכל אתר אינטרנט עם גרסת הדפדפן שבחרת על ידך דפדפן Tor.

עד לפוסט הבא, שעוסק ב LibreOffice. כשאני משאיר אותך עם הפרסום החדש והמשימה המרגשת הזו של ניתוח ומחקר.

הדרכה גרפית של הנוהל

תיקיה אישית_001 תיקיה אישית_002 root @ hostmovil-sysadmin: -home-sysadmin_003 אזור עבודה 1_004תצורת רשת Tor_005 מצב Tor_006 דפדפן Tor_007 אינדקס של -torbrowser - דפדפן Tor_008 אודות Tor_009 הדפדפן אודות Tor - דפדפן Tor_010


תוכן המאמר עומד בעקרונותינו של אתיקה עריכתית. כדי לדווח על שגיאה לחץ כאן.

7 תגובות, השאר את שלך

השאירו את התגובה שלכם

כתובת הדוא"ל שלך לא תפורסם. שדות חובה מסומנים *

*

*

  1. אחראי לנתונים: מיגל אנחל גטון
  2. מטרת הנתונים: בקרת ספאם, ניהול תגובות.
  3. לגיטימציה: הסכמתך
  4. מסירת הנתונים: הנתונים לא יועברו לצדדים שלישיים אלא בהתחייבות חוקית.
  5. אחסון נתונים: מסד נתונים המתארח על ידי Occentus Networks (EU)
  6. זכויות: בכל עת תוכל להגביל, לשחזר ולמחוק את המידע שלך.

  1.   דיין קו דיג'ו

    למרות שדפדפן Firefox המותאם על ידי פרויקט TOR להפעלת אתרים עם .onion, משמש גם לניווט באתרים רגילים, לא הכל הוא "הרשת העמוקה", שהם פשוט דפים שאינם רעיוניים ומוסתרים כדי לנצל את TOR ואת ה- At. יחד עם זאת, אל תספק מידע מתפשר, ישנן המלצות:
    1. לעולם אל תבקר באותם אתרים באותו מחשב בו זמנית, תוך החלפת רשת רגילה ורשת בצל.
    2. לעולם אל תיכנס ל- TOR, למשל פייסבוק, TORbook או כל דוא"ל.
    3. השתמש במנוע חיפוש מאובטח שלא עוקב אחריך, למשל קישור DuckDuckGo: https://duckduckgo.com
    כמו גם המראה שלו ב .ionion
    4. השבת JavaScript, מכיוון שהוא יכול להריץ חלקים מקוד קנייני ולפגוע בפרטיותך ובשלמות המחשב שלך.
    5. השתמש ב- TAILS או בהפצה אחרת המכוונת לפרטיות, היישומים והקשרים שלך נאלצים להיות מוצפנים דרך רשת TOR.
    6. התקן HTTPS בכל מקום והצפן את התנועה שלך.

    יתכן ויש המלצות נוספות ממשתמשים אחרים, אני מזמין אותך לשתף חוויות והצעות לפרויקט זה. לתרום, לפתח, להשתמש, לתרום!
    ברכות!

  2.   אינג 'חוסה אלברט דיג'ו

    טוב מאוד התגובה שלך ותרומות שלך!

    אני מברך אותך על יכולתך.

  3.   ראול פ דיג'ו

    מהנדס ברכות, אני אוהב את ההדרכות שלך.

    גזאפו: «המאפשר לנו להסתיר»

  4.   אינג 'חוסה אלברט דיג'ו

    כן, תמיד משהו הולך, הכל לא מושלם לחלוטין!

  5.   חוסה לינארס דיג'ו

    השיטה בה אתה משתמש כדי להשיג את המשתמש הנוכחי שגויה, היא מחזירה את המשתמש עם UID 1000. בסדר, אם יש רק משתמש אחד, זה בדרך כלל זה, אבל זה לא חייב להיות המקרה. לא עדיף להשתמש ב- user = $ (whoami)?
    וגם לא צריך לקרוא לבית זהה למשתמש. למרבה המזל, המשתנה ~ מכיל תמיד את נתיב הבית.

  6.   אינג 'חוסה אלברט דיג'ו

    זכור שעם Shell Scripting אתה יכול לעשות הרבה דברים מורכבים שהם חוצה פלטפורמות (Different Distros) באמצעות קבצים קטנים מאוד. אשאיר לך את התסריט הקטן הזה של משהו שילמד אותך בקרוב, למי שימשיך לצפות בקורס, וזה עם 50Kb בלבד מבטיח הרבה! וזה רק חצי ממה שאתה יכול לעשות עם Scripting Shell.

    LPI-SB8 ScreenCast (LINUX POST INSTALL - SCRIPT BICENTENARIO 8.0.0)
    (lpi_sb8_adecuación-audiovisual_2016.sh / 43Kb)

    ראה Screencast: https://www.youtube.com/watch?v=cWpVQcbgCyY

  7.   אינג 'חוסה אלברט דיג'ו

    ברכה לכל מי שעוקב אחר הקורס המקוון של "למד Scripting Shell" בקרוב נמשיך עם סקריפטים בסיסיים אחרים כדי להמשיך לנכס את הידע ולהמשיך לחבר אותו לכל אחד.

    אני מקווה שתישאר מעודכן כי בקרוב אתחיל בקודים מתקדמים יותר אך ייחשף בצורה מובנת מבחינה ויזואלית למרות מורכבותה.

    LPI-SB8 ScreenCast (LINUX POST INSTALL - SCRIPT BICENTENARIO 8.0.0)
    (lpi_sb8_adecuación-audiovisual_2016.sh / 43Kb)

    ראה Screencast: https://www.youtube.com/watch?v=cWpVQcbgCyY